使用谷歌浏览器的虚拟变换功能
随着互联网技术的不断发展,用户对浏览器功能的需求也在不断提高。谷歌浏览器(Google Chrome)作为全球最受欢迎的浏览器之一,凭借其快速、安全和高效的特点,吸引了亿万用户的青睐。在众多功能中,虚拟变换(Virtual Transform)功能是一项非常实用的功能,它能够为用户提供更优质的网页浏览体验。本文将深入探讨谷歌浏览器的虚拟变换功能,以及如何高效利用它。
虚拟变换功能的基本概念
虚拟变换是谷歌浏览器中的一项前端开发功能,主要应用于CSS(层叠样式表)中,允许开发者在网页上实现更复杂和生动的动画效果。它利用计算机图形学的原理,使得元素在页面中的移动、旋转、缩放等效果更加流畅和自然。此外,虚拟变换功能通过GPU加速来提高表现性能,确保即使在轻便的设备上也能保持良好的用户体验。
虚拟变换的常见应用场景
1. **优化用户界面**:不少网站在设计时会使用虚拟变换来实现菜单的展开与收缩、按钮的悬停效果等。这些效果能够让界面更加生动,吸引用户的注意力,同时提升整体交互体验。
2. **增强内容展示**:在电商网站上,虚拟变换可以用于商品图像的缩放和旋转,让用户在浏览时能更全面地查看产品细节。这种动态效果可以有效增加潜在客户的购买欲望。
3. **创造引人入胜的动画**:许多高端网站和应用都有丰富的动画效果,以提升品牌形象。虚拟变换技术能够帮助开发者轻松实现这些特效,增强用户的浏览体验。
如何在谷歌浏览器中使用虚拟变换功能
对于普通用户而言,虚拟变换的使用主要体现在访问页面的表现上,而开发者则需要更深入地掌握其实现方法。以下是开发者使用虚拟变换功能的简要步骤:
1. **学习CSS变换属性**:了解CSS3中提供的`transform`属性,包括`translate`、`rotate`、`scale`和`skew`等。这些属性可以组合使用,创造出丰富的效果。例如:
```css
.element {
transform: translateX(50px) rotate(45deg);
}
```
2. **使用过渡和动画**:为了使变换效果更为平滑,可以结合CSS的`transition`或`animation`属性。例如:
```css
.element {
transition: transform 0.3s ease-in-out;
}
.element:hover {
transform: scale(1.1);
}
```
3. **GPU加速**:在某些情况下,可以通过添加`will-change`属性提示浏览器优化性能。这能显著提升复杂动画的流畅度。例如:
```css
.element {
will-change: transform;
}
```
4. **测试与优化**:使用谷歌浏览器的开发者工具(F12)来调试和优化虚拟变换的效果。开发者可以查看动画的运行时间以及任何可能影响性能的问题。
总结
谷歌浏览器的虚拟变换功能为网页开发带来了众多便利,帮助开发者实现生动、有趣的用户体验。通过合理运用CSS变换属性和动画效果,网站能够向用户展示更丰富的内容,从而吸引并留住访问者。虽然普通用户在日常使用中可能不会直接接触到这一功能,但他们无疑将在每一次浏览时感受到其带来的便利和改善。不断学习和掌握这种前端技术,将是提升用户体验和网站功能的重要一步。